Exactly WHAT kind of profits are we talking about?  The Democrats keep spouting descriptions like “outrageous” or “immoral” even “obscene” – but those are not hard numbers.  Give me a number – OK – if that’s too proprietary – give me a profit margin…a percentage – anything that gives me a reality check on all of these none-sense description.

Well – the Associated Press released an article called “FACT CHECK: Health insurer profits not so fat” – and I’ll tell you – “not so fat” is being kind!  As a matter of fact – the magic number…drum roll please…

…margins typically run about 6 percent, give or take a point or two.

To make it even worse…

Profits barely exceeded 2 percent of revenues in the latest annual measure.
